How to Get Your Punk Boyfriend a Good Birthday Present
If you have a punk boyfriend and you want to make sure he has the best birthday ever with his girl...read these tips!
EditSteps
-
1First of all, keep in mind that punk boyfriends don't expect much for their birthday! Don't stress - A kiss and a homemade birthday card is all you really need.Ad
-
2Find out what kind of punk he is. These days, the term "punk" can mean almost anything. In music alone, there are many sub-genres. What exactly does he enjoy? Which bands does he like? How does he dress? Does he like black leather, piercings, Mohawks, or just plain t-shirts and jeans?
-
3Take stock of what he already has. No sense in giving him a gift if he already has it.
-
4Check to see if any one of his favorite bands is playing in your area, near or around the time of his birthday. Punk shows are a great birthday present.
-
5Try to remember things that your boy friend has mentioned that he wanted to buy -- Cd's, posters, clothes or musical instruments/accessories -- and check if he already bought them. If not, then you can give him one (or a bunch) of those.
-
6Consider buying him a subscription to a magazine that interests him.
-
7Check out "Angry Young and Poor" and "Studs and Spikes" on the web. They have a ton of punk merchandise from all genres. If you can't find something he would like, they have gift certificates so that he can pick out his own stuff.
-
8Ask his friends for suggestions.
-
9If he's into piercing or tattoo, take him to a tattoo shop and pay for his new tattoo or piercing he's been thinking about.Ad

EditTips
- If you're not sure whether your boyfriend already has the present that you're considering, ask his friends, family members, or take a good look around when you're in his place; just don't make it too obvious.
- A lot of punks are also politically active. Look into popular books, movies, and Cd's that relate to his political interest.
EditWarnings
- If you're going to give him clothes, make sure that they will fit him. A lot of people go wrong in picking the correct size, even for people they're close to.
- One person's interpretation of "punk" may not fit another person's interpretation...it's very much necessary to figure out his favorite bands, and his interests. Does he like old-school punk (Ramones, Sex Pistols, Richard Hell, The Adicts), Anarcho-punk(Subhumans, Crass, Rudimentary Peni, Witch Hunt), Crust Punk(Aus-Rotten, Toxic Narcotic, F-Minus, Antischism), Hardcore Punk(Dead Kennedys, Circle Jerks, Black Flag, Husker Du, M.D.C.), hardcore(Minor Threat, Void, Government Issue, Scream), Skacore(Leftover Crack/Choking Victim, Operation Ivy, Suicide Machines, Voodoo Glow Skulls), or Thrash Punk(DRI, Suicidal Tendencies, Cro-Mags, The Exploited)
